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/python/313.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python Tensorflow数据集-映射json_Python_Json_Tensorflow_Tensorflow Datasets - Fatal编程技术网

Python Tensorflow数据集-映射json

Python Tensorflow数据集-映射json,python,json,tensorflow,tensorflow-datasets,Python,Json,Tensorflow,Tensorflow Datasets,我正在尝试使用dataset api构建数据集,我的情况如下: 我有一组json,为每个实例指示两个图像(在我的例子中是图像及其掩码) 我想映射每个json,并将两个图像作为张量返回 在纯python中,我会执行以下操作 import json import tensorflow as tf def parse_json(json_path): json_file = json.load(open(json_path)) img = tf.io.read_file(json_file['

我正在尝试使用dataset api构建数据集,我的情况如下:

  • 我有一组json,为每个实例指示两个图像(在我的例子中是图像及其掩码)
  • 我想映射每个json,并将两个图像作为张量返回
  • 在纯python中,我会执行以下操作

    import json
    import tensorflow as tf
    def parse_json(json_path):
      json_file = json.load(open(json_path))
      img = tf.io.read_file(json_file['img'])
      mask = tf.io.read_file(json_file['mask']
    
      return img, mask
    
    如何使用Tensorflow API实现相同的结果? 谢谢你的帮助